Crowdsourcing Theme Design

Crowdsourcing Theme Design

Hi everyone, just signing up as I've got a potential first client / family friend (so its a good opportunity to make some learning mistakes) who wants an online shop which Magento is well suited for. 

 

I've previously developed in Wordpress and after reading/watching tutorials about Magento have a good understanding of the basics. My design skills are poor, so I'm looking to outsource the design to one of these crowdfunding sites like 99designs or designcrowd. In the specification I need to write the list of pages/blocks that need to be designed. My list looks like so:

  • Homepage
  • Category Page
  • Single Product Page
  • Search Results Page
  • Text based page with common element styles (to be used for about us, delivery info, etc)
  • Sign in / register page
  • Checkout & basket pages
  • Review pages

 

Have I missed anything?

 

I'll probably end up asking the designer to design just the homepage and product page as part of the competition and will ask for the design to complete the rest separately. I'll then find a suitable PSD to Magento coder and move like that. Any tips/advice would be most welcome.

Re: Crowdsourcing Theme Design

You don't need to worry about search page as it's almost identical to category pages.

 

What you need to consider also are 404 page, compare, wishlist and My Account pages (there is a metric ton of those). Also it's good idea to spend some effort designing Purchase Successful page as it's always a good idea to be nice with someone who just gave you money.

Re: Crowdsourcing Theme Design

Most important pages are front page, category page, product page and 404 (this can be omitted if you really feel like cutting corners). Everything else can done using style elements (buttons, headers, tables, lists and so on).
